Daley and Barahona Earn Weekly Men's Volleyball Honors
PLAYER OF THE WEEK — Newbury College senior middle blocker Max Daley (Cranston, R.I.) hit .463 for the week amassing 58 kills in 19 sets played. The Nighthawks went 2-3 on the week defeating Elmira (3-1) and Kean (3-2), while falling to Rivier (3-0), #6 Philadelphia Biblical (3-1) and #10 Carthage (3-0). Despite the tough loss against ranked Philly, Daley hit an amazing .714 with tallying 16 kills in four sets. He averaged 3.0 kills per set and 0.89 blocks per set (17 blocks).
ROOKIE OF THE WEEK —Southern Vermont College freshman outside hitter Anthony Barahona (Eagle Rock, Calif.) helped the Mountaineers to a 1-1 week defeating Regis 3-0 and narrowly falling to NECC opponent Daniel Webster 3-2. Barahona averaged 3.75 kills per game and 3.12 digs per set. He hit .348 tallying 40 kills. He chipped in four assists, three service aces and three blocks.
